Who We Are:
Interra Health is a fast-growing healthcare technology company transforming how providers and patients navigate the prescription journey. Formed through the merger of DoseSpot, Arrive Health, and pVerify, Interra Health delivers trusted eligibility, real-time coverage and pricing insights, prescribing tools, and pharmacy transparency at the point of care—helping providers make informed decisions and patients access the right medications with greater clarity and affordability. Backed by strong market momentum and a bold vision for the future of connected care, Interra Health offers the chance to join an innovative, mission-driven team working at the intersection of software and healthcare to reduce friction, improve access, and make the healthcare experience better for everyone.

Interra Health is the parent company of DoseSpot and pVerify — two leading healthcare technology platforms serving thousands of healthcare organizations across the country. DoseSpot provides best-in-class ePrescribing solutions for EHRs, telemedicine platforms, and practice management systems. pVerify delivers real-time insurance eligibility verification and patient coverage solutions to healthcare providers, health systems, RCM companies, pharmacies, and Health IT vendors.

What you need to know about the Colorado Tech Scene

With a business-friendly climate and research universities like CU Boulder and Colorado State, Colorado has made a name for itself as a startup ecosystem. The state boasts a skilled workforce and high quality of life thanks to its affordable housing, vibrant cultural scene and unparalleled opportunities for outdoor recreation. Colorado is also home to the National Renewable Energy Laboratory, helping cement its status as a hub for renewable energy innovation.

Key Facts About Colorado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 260,000; 8.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Lockheed Martin, Century Link, Comcast, BAE Systems, Level 3
  • Key Industries: Software, artificial intelligence, aerospace, e-commerce, fintech, healthtech
  • Funding Landscape: $4.9 billion in VC fun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Access Venture Partners, Ridgeline Ventures, Techstars, Blackhorn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: Colorado School of Mines, University of Colorado Boulder, University of Denver, Colorado State University, Mesa Laboratory, Space Science Institute, National Center for Atmospheric Research, National Renewable Energy Laboratory, Gottlieb Institute
